Dr. Nate Zinsser on Finding a Mindset of Confidence

Dr. Nate Zinsser is an expert in the psychology of human performance who consults to individuals and organizations seeking a competitive edge. He is the director of west point’s influential performance psychology program. His new book is The Confident Mind: A Battle Tested Guide to Unshakeable Performance. In this discussion, we not only define confidence but debunk some commonly held beliefs on what it means to have confidence in yourself despite that voice in your head that's always saying you're not good enough.
